Fantasy Impact: The Ottawa Senators have fired Head Coach Paul MacLean. Replacing him is (now former) Assistant Coach Dave Cameron.

 

Ottawa gets: a 56-year-old former fringe NHLer (centerman) who played a gritty brand of hockey. Cameron coached in the OHL from 1997 through 2011, other than four seasons in which he was in the AHL (one with the Marlies as an assistant in 1999 and three as Head Coach of Binghamton). Cameron is reportedly given the head coaching job in Ottawa “without the interim tag”.

 

 

Any time a new coach takes over, status quo is obviously compromised. Right now, Hoffman is getting the sheltered minutes, as well as Stone. Legwand is getting tough minutes. This could remain the same, or it could be turned on its head. If Hoffman starts to get less-than-ideal minutes, his production will dry up. And perhaps Legwand starts to produce.

 

The team as a whole was not driving possession. Generally a shake-up like a coach being fired will put things back on track, at least for the short term.
